On the morning of April 25, the Nghe An Provincial Labor Federation coordinated with the Department of Home Affairs to organize a ceremony to celebrate the 140th anniversary of International Labor Day and launch Workers' Month, Action Month for Occupational Safety and Health in 2026.

Attending the program were Ms. Vo Thi Minh Sinh - Deputy Secretary of the Provincial Party Committee, Chairman of the Provincial Vietnam Fatherland Front Committee; Mr. Nguyen Van De - Vice Chairman of the Provincial People's Committee; along with representatives of departments, agencies, branches, socio-political organizations and more than 400 workers, civil servants, and laborers.

Speaking at the ceremony, Mr. Kha Van Tam - Chairman of the Nghe An Provincial Labor Federation emphasized that International Labor Day May 1 is a global symbol of solidarity and struggle for the legitimate rights and interests of workers.

From the historic struggle in Chicago (USA) in 1886 with the demands of "8 hours of work – 8 hours of rest – 8 hours of fun", the workers' movement spread widely, creating the foundation for many important social advances.

In Vietnam, under the leadership of the Party, the working class has always played a pioneering role through revolutionary periods. From the struggle for independence to the period of renovation and integration, the working class has continuously grown stronger, directly contributing to economic growth and social stability.

In Nghe An alone, the tradition of workers associated with historical movements such as Truong Thi - Ben Thuy continues to be inherited and promoted. In recent years, the team of workers, civil servants, and laborers of the province has developed both in quantity and quality, playing a core role in production, especially in industrial parks.

In 2025, Nghe An's economy achieved GRDP growth of about 8.44%, higher than the national average; export turnover reached about 4.52 billion USD, and budget revenue was more than 29,000 billion VND. This result clearly reflects the contribution of the labor force throughout the province.

Stepping into 2026, Q1 growth continues to maintain positive momentum, showing that the economy is shifting towards sustainability, based on productivity and technology application. In this process, workers are not only a productive force but also creative subjects, contributing many initiatives and technical improvements that bring practical efficiency.

However, the labor force is still facing many challenges such as job pressure, income, increasing demands for skills, risks of labor insecurity and impacts from global economic fluctuations. This requires levels and sectors to innovate their approach to caring for and protecting workers' rights.

In 2026, Workers' Month is implemented with the theme "Vietnamese Workers: Innovation, Improving Labor Productivity", associated with the Action Month on Occupational Safety and Health with the message "Proactive Prevention - Protecting Workers in the Digital Age".

On this occasion, the Nghe An Provincial Labor Federation supported the construction and repair of 20 "Trade Union Solidarity Houses" for workers in difficult circumstances with a total budget of 850 million VND; and presented gifts to 54 union members who suffered labor accidents or were in special circumstances, each gift worth 1 million VND.

The People's Committee of Nghe An province has also rewarded 40 workers with outstanding achievements in labor production in 2025.
